####Electromagnetic interference: the invisible threat of smart locks**
In daily life, we may not be aware of it, but the ubiquitous electromagnetic waves constantly affect the normal operation of electronic devices. As a product that integrates various high-tech elements such as wireless communication and biometric recognition, smart locks are highly sensitive to electromagnetic environments. Whether it is unintentional interference from neighboring Wi Fi signals or interference implemented by malicious attackers using electromagnetic pulses, it can lead to malfunctions such as false unlocking and inability to respond to commands in smart locks. In severe cases, it may even completely fail, posing a huge risk to home security.
####Anti interference absorption plate: an innovative solution in technology**
Faced with this challenge, the intelligent lock anti-interference absorbing wave plate developed by Advanced Institute Technology has emerged. This wave absorbing plate adopts advanced electromagnetic materials, which can effectively absorb and disperse the surrounding electromagnetic wave energy, reducing its interference with the internal electronic components of the smart lock. Unlike traditional shielding materials, absorption plates are designed to focus more on "guidance" rather than simple "blocking". Through a precisely calculated absorption structure, electromagnetic waves are converted into harmless thermal energy, thereby achieving efficient anti-interference without affecting the normal wireless communication of smart locks.
